My style is warm, open and non-judgmental. I use an approach called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) most often and supplement with tools in mindfulness and self-compassion. CBT helps you to identify unhelpful thinking styles and their impact. Through the use of specific techniques, my clients learn how to challenge unhelpful thinking styles and negative beliefs about themselves resulting in more effective responses to difficult situations, reduction and/or elimination of symptoms of depression and anxiety , a more positive self-image, and reduction in stress responses. I am trained in CBT for insomnia as well and many of my clients have benefited from this structured intervention.
Mindfulness and self-compassion are two great tools that I often teach to clients. My clients have consistently given excellent feedback on how all three of these methods positively impact their lives.
